Dedicado a mis proyectos en Gambas ,un lenguaje de programación parecido al Visual Basic + Java pero ampliamente mejorado y...¡¡para gnu/linux!!.La potencia del gnu/linux sumada a la facilidad del Basic



Consultas, Desarrollo de programas y petición de presupuestos:



viernes, 25 de octubre de 2013

Nueva Versión de Gambas: 3.5.0

   Nueva Versión de Gambas: 3.5.0



Acaba de salir del "horno", una nueva versión de gambas 3.5.0


PPA, para Ubuntu y derivadas:
$sudo add-apt-repository ppa:nemh/gambas3  
$sudo apt-get update
$sudo apt-get install gambas3


Notas de esta versión:

¿que hay de nuevo?
Esta nueva versión corrige más de 240 errores y añade más de 270 nuevas características (sí, los mismos números que en Gambas 3.4).

Tenga en cuenta que muchos de estos errores ya se han portado a las versiones 3.4.x.

He aquí un resumen de los principales cambios:

Entorno de desarrollo
El editor de menús ha sido corregido.
Se proporciona un nuevo editor de imágenes .
El editor de la base de datos ahora puede recordar un número arbitrario de peticiones SQL para cada conexión.
Apoyo Subversion ha sido corregido.
Si el IDE genera un error inesperado Gambas , todos los archivos modificados se guardan automáticamente antes de salir.
Aplicación web se puede depurar el IDE a través de las páginas integradas de http gb.httpd componente de servidor .

Intérprete y compilador
Application.Priority es una nueva propiedad que permite definir la prioridad de planificación del proceso actual ( o tarea "task" ) .
Match es un nuevo operador que cargue automáticamente el componente gb.pcre implementar coincidencia de patrones PCRE .
Soporte de manejador de error global . 
Soporte ARM se ha corregido y Gambas debe ser confiable ahora en esa arquitectura.
Nuevo. [ Xxx ] y ! Xxx sintaxis que se puede utilizar dentro de una With ... End With estructura como accesos directos de descriptor de acceso de matriz.

Componentes
gb.clipper es un nuevo componente basado en la biblioteca Clipper .
gb.openssl es un nuevo componente en anidar funciones criptográficas de libcrypto del proyecto OpenSSL .
FileProperties es un nuevo control que muestra las propiedades de un archivo o directorio específico .
ImageView es un nuevo control que permite la visualización de una imagen dentro de una vista desplazado , en los diferentes niveles de zoom.
Control deslizante es un nuevo control que muestra un cursor y una SpinBox , ambos están sincronizados.
Horizontal barras de herramientas ahora puede crecer verticalmente si no hay suficiente espacio para los elementos de la barra de herramientas .
gb.gmp es un nuevo componente basado en el múltiple de precisión aritmética Biblioteca GNU que implementa BigInt y números racionales .
El componente gb.image tiene nuevos métodos para aplicar efectos de equilibrio para una imagen.
gb.media ahora está basado en GStreamer 1.0 . El control MediaPlayer ahora puede tomar una captura de pantalla del cuadro de video actual.
gb.openal es un nuevo componente basado en la biblioteca de audio 3D OpenAL .
gb.opengl.sge es nuevo componente que implementa un motor de juego OpenGL simple basado en el formato MD2 .
gb.xml.rpc ahora es mucho más fiable .